Lompat ke konten Lompat ke sidebar Lompat ke footer
Apa Itu Cache ? Inilah Pengertian, Fungsi, dan Cara Kerja Cache

Apa Itu Cache ? Inilah Pengertian, Fungsi, dan Cara Kerja Cache

Pengertian Cache
Cache adalah metode penyimpanan data sementara berkecepatan tinggi untuk menyimpan data yang sering diakses agar aksesnya cepat. Cache terdapat pada level hardware dan software. Contoh di level hardware adalah cache pada processor, yaitu L1,L2,dan L3, sedangkan di level software terdapat di sistem browser yang sering kita gunakan untuk menjelajah internet.

Fungsi Cache
Cache berfungsi sebagai tempat penyimpanan data sementara yang sering diakses agar nantinya dapat diakses kembali dengan cepat ketika dibutuhkan.

Cara Kerja Cache
Cache memiliki 2 tipe operasi yaitu read dan write. Di mode read, ketika cache menemukan data di bagian teratas atau cache hit, maka sistem akan mengembalikan data tersebut dan operasi selesai. Sebaliknya, jika tidak ditemukan, cache akan membaca data di bawahnya lagi. Di mode write, cache akan menulis data di memori teratas yang belum digunakan.


Kelebihan Cache

Akses Lebih Cepat

Akses memori cache biasanya lebih cepat dibandingkan memori utama.

Biasanya Berukuran Kecil
Data yang disimpan dalam cache biasanya tidak terlalu besar karena hanya menyimpan data yang sering digunakan saja.

Kekurangan Cache

Kapasitas Terbatas

Kapasitas cache terbatas terutama pada prosesor yang saat ini hanya mampu menyimpan cache kurang dari 20 MB.

Hardware Mahal
Hardware untuk sistem cache ini memang mahal sehingga tidak efektif jika digunakan untuk menyimpan data yang besar.
Open Comments

Posting Komentar untuk "Apa Itu Cache ? Inilah Pengertian, Fungsi, dan Cara Kerja Cache"